What’s Coming in Monster Hunter Wilds Title Update 1 & Roadmap

Monster Hunter Wilds Title Update 1 – Mizutsune, Event Quests, & Additional Updates

Mizutsune in Monster Hunter Wilds

Image by Capcom
Leading the charge in the first major update is the return of Mizutsune, a fan-favorite dragon-type monster known for its aquatic habitat and debilitating bubble attacks that can inflict Bubbleblight. Its striking pink scales and purple fur not only make it a formidable foe but also a source of some of the most visually appealing gear in the game.

The trailer showcased Mizutsune ambushing the new monster, Doshaguma, suggesting that its attack patterns will remain consistent with previous iterations. However, the specific location where hunters will encounter Mizutsune in *Monster Hunter Wilds* has yet to be disclosed.

Accompanying Mizutsune, Title Update 1 will introduce a fresh batch of Event Quests, accessible via the game’s Mission Board. These quests typically challenge players to defeat various monsters for rewarding loot. While the exact number of new Event Quests remains under wraps, they promise to keep hunters engaged and well-equipped.

Additionally, the update will include "additional updates" slated for spring, though specifics are currently unavailable. These could range from performance optimizations to other enhancements, crucial for ensuring a smooth gameplay experience in *Monster Hunter Wilds*. Feedback from the recent beta test suggests the game is on track for a robust launch.

Monster Hunter Wilds Summer Title Update 2 & Beyond

Monster Hunter Wilds Summer Update

Image by Capcom
The roadmap also teases a second Title Update in Summer 2025, promising the introduction of another new monster. Whether this will be a fresh face or a returning favorite is yet to be revealed, keeping the community buzzing with anticipation. More Event Quests will also be added, ensuring continuous engagement for players.

While details beyond these two updates are scarce, Capcom's commitment to a successful launch hints at more content to come. Stay tuned for further announcements and surprises.
